    About Pendleton

    Pendleton, Indiana, offers a charming blend of small-town tranquility and accessible living, a refreshing contrast to the hustle of larger cities. With a population just shy of 5,000, this community fosters a close-knit atmosphere where neighbors know each other and the pace of life feels intentionally slower. The real gem here is affordability; you can secure a home for a median value of around $214,600, a significant bargain compared to the national median. This financial breathing room allows residents to enjoy the simple pleasures of life, from strolls through the historic downtown to community events, all while maintaining a comfortable lifestyle.

    For those considering an investment or a move, Pendleton presents a compelling proposition. The median household income of approximately $81,413 comfortably exceeds the national average, suggesting a financially stable community. The housing market is particularly attractive for first-time buyers or those seeking to downsize without sacrificing quality of life. While specific employment data isn't available, the strong local economy supports a range of opportunities, and the town's low crime rates contribute to a safe and secure environment. Pendleton is ideally suited for families, young professionals, and retirees alike, offering a balanced lifestyle that prioritizes community and affordability.

    Pendleton, Indiana at a Glance

    Pendleton is a city in Pendleton town, Indiana with a population of approximately 4,937. The median home value is $214,600 and the median household income is $81,413.. The violent crime rate is 0.0 per 1,000 residents, which is 100% below the national average.. Median rent is $1,064 per month. Data sourced from the US Census Bureau, FBI Crime Data Explorer, EPA, Walk Score, and FEMA.
